Reliance Jio has announced two new mobile applications: JioSafe and JioTranslate. These new offerings underscore Jio’s dedication to enhancing user experience through advanced technological solutions. The apps are launching alongside updated tariffs which see Jio hiking the price of its prepaid plans by up to Rs 600.

JioSafe: Quantum-Secure Communication
JioSafe, priced at Rs 199 per month, is a revolutionary communication app that offers quantum-secure calling, messaging, and file transfer capabilities. This application is designed to provide security for personal and business communications, ensuring that users’ data remains protected from any potential cyber threats. The quantum encryption technology employed by JioSafe represents the next generation of digital security, making it a vital tool for anyone concerned about privacy and data integrity in their communications.
JioTranslate: AI-Powered Multi-Lingual Communication
The second application, JioTranslate, is an AI-powered multi-lingual communication tool available at Rs 99 per month. This app can translate voice calls, voice messages, text, and images across multiple languages, breaking down language barriers and facilitating seamless communication. Whether for personal use, travel, or business, JioTranslate’s advanced AI capabilities ensure accurate and swift translations, making it an indispensable resource in today’s globalised world.

Free for Jio users for a year
In an exceptional offer to its users, Jio is providing both JioSafe and JioTranslate applications free of charge for the first year. This offer, valued at Rs 298 per month, aims to provide Jio users with access to these innovative tools without any additional cost, reinforcing Jio’s mission to deliver superior value and services to its customer base.
Jio price hike
Reliance Jio today also announced that it is raising the prices of its prepaid and postpaid plans, impacting millions of users across the country. The new prices will be up to Rs 600 higher, following a trend in the telecom industry to increase rates for better network and services. These changes will start from July 3, 2024.
